PERKINS, George (Burton)

PERKINS, George (Burton). American, b. 1930. Genres: Novels, Literary criticism and history, Travel/Exploration, Humor/Satire. Career: Teaching Assistant, Cornell University, Ithaca, NY, 1955-57; Instructor, Washington University, St. Louis, 1957-60; Assistant Professor, Baldwin-Wallace College, Berea, OH, 1960-63, and Fairleigh Dickinson University, Rutherford, NJ, 1963-66; Lecturer in American Literature, University of Edinburgh, 1966-67; Associate Professor, 1967-70, Director of Graduate Studies in English, 1969-73, Professor of English, 1970-2001, General Ed. of Journal of Narrative Technique, 1971-92, and Director, Collegium for Advanced Studies, 1995-97, Eastern Michigan University, Ypsilanti. Fellow, Institute for Adv. Studies in the Humanities, University of Edinburgh, 1981; Sr. Ful- bright Fellow, University of Newcastle, NSW, 1989. Publications: Writing Clear Prose, 1964; (with Frye and Baker) The Practical Imagination: An Introduction to Poetry, 1983; (with Frye and Baker) The Harper Handbook to Literature, 1985, (with Fry, Baker, and Perkins) 2nd ed., 1997; (with B. Perkins) Contemporary American Literature, 1988; (with B. Perkins) Kaleidoscope, 1993; (with B. Perkins) Women's Work: An Anthology of American Literature, 1994; A Season in New South Wales, 1998. EDITOR: Varieties of Prose, 1966; The Theory of the American Novel, 1970; Realistic American Short Fiction, 1972; American Poetic Theory, 1972; (with B. Perkins) The American Tradition in Literature, 4th ed., 1974, 10th ed., 2002; (with Frye and Baker) The Practical Imagination, 1980, compact ed., 1987; (with B. Perkins and P.
